Type of juicer
For citrus fruits – They are intended for obtaining juice from citrus fruits only. Easy to use and relatively inexpensive compared to universal juicers. They are compact and easy to clean. The density of the juice can be adjusted using the holes through which the juice enters the bowl.
Universal (centrifugal) – Designed for many vegetables and fruits, including citrus fruits. Depending on the type of separator are divided into two types:
- With a cylindrical separator – it gives more juice, but there is no automatic waste of cake for it. It quickly becomes clogged and needs to be disassembled and washed by hand;
- With canonical separator – the cake is collected in a separate tank; it is easy to remove. But this model has less performance.
Universal juicers have a complex structure and, accordingly, are much more expensive than citrus juicers. A significant drawback is the duration and complexity of washing. Sometimes this process can last up to 20 minutes.
Of the minuses, a large amount of pulp and foam in the juice can be noted. The juice itself is heated, released in small drops and therefore oxidized due to contact with air, therefore, part of the vitamins are destroyed. Some models give a rather wet cake, which affects their productivity: more moisture in the cake – less juice at the exit.
Although universal juicers are suitable for citrus fruits, pressing them can cause problems if the bones get on the filter and damage it. This also applies to fruits and berries with seeds, for example, the juice from pomegranate berries, gooseberries cannot be done.
Combined – have many additional built-in features. As a standard, these are juicers that combine the functions of the two types listed above. Sometimes they may include features such as slicing vegetables, as well as some functions of a blender, for example, for mixing liquids. Meet quite rarely. Are expensive. It is better to buy two juicers (for citrus and universal) if the means allow and there is a place for their storage.
Screw – consist of a screw shaft and mesh (the principle of operation is similar to a meat grinder). They operate at lower speeds, due to which they are quieter in operation. In fact, the juice is obtained by cold pressing or pressing. It should be noted that in such juice all the beneficial enzymes and vitamins that die when heated are most preserved. The performance of screw juicers is higher than any other, and juice can be obtained from any fruit and vegetables, including root crops, herbs, and berries. Such products are more expensive.
There are single and twin screw juicers. The second is distinguished by a wide range of products from which juice can be obtained. Also, disassemble and wash them longer. But the juice is purer and in larger quantities.

Number of speeds
The number of speeds ranges from 1 to 9. For normal operation, 2-3 speeds are sufficient. Soft vegetables and fruits are best squeezed at low speeds, hard – at higher. It should be borne in mind that at high speed more pulp enters the juice, and at low speed, it remains transparent.
Body material
Plastic case – such models are light, inexpensive, have different colors and are easy to clean. The main disadvantage is low strength.
- Stainless steel case – they are characterized by high strength, but such juicers are heavy and expensive.
- Mesh material
- Universal models are best purchased with a stainless mesh (it is more durable).
- A plastic grid is quite suitable for a citrus juice squeezer since the effect on it will be minimal.
Juice tank
As you know, the juice is a perishable product, so the volume of the tank must be selected depending on the amount of consumption of the drink at a time. The best option is 1-2 glasses, that is, approximately 300-600 ml.
Hole width
The width of the hole ranges from 35 to 90 mm. It should be selected depending on which fruit will be used. The average apple size is about 75 mm. This indicator does not greatly affect the price, so it is better to choose a juicer with a large hole.
Extra options
Reverse – characteristic for citrus juicers. Thanks to the rotation of the cone nozzle in turn left-right, you can get more juice.
- The clamping mechanism is a special press that makes it easier to get juice from citrus fruits.
- Cleaning brushes – necessary for cleaning universal juicers, which are difficult to wash due to sharp small cells.
- “Drop-stop” – the ability to raise the nose of the juicer in between juice extraction. Leftovers will not drip onto the table.
Tips
Here it is worth paying special attention to cleaning the sieves from the waste: when dried, they will solidify and make good juice will be impossible.
- Parts of juicers cannot be washed in dishwashers due to the presence of rubber parts.
- Rinse the juicer immediately after work using brushes.
